Don’t Forget: Next Free Walk is Sunday

The N.J. Meadowlands Commission's next free guided nature walk with Bergen County Audubon is DeKorte Park this Sunday, Sept. 4, beginning at 10 a.m.

Although the Marsh Dicovery Trail will be closed, there still should be good birds around.

Full details follow. 


Sunday, Sept. 4, 10 a.m. 
First-Sunday-of-the-Month Nature Walk with the NJMC and BCAS

This free two-hour guided nature walk starts outside the Meadowlands Environment Center in DeKorte Park in Lyndhurst, and runs from 10 a.m. We’ll walk around the square-mile park, looking for migrating shorebirds, butterflies and various egrets and herons. The walk is run by the N.J. Meadowlands Commission and the Bergen County Audubon Society. Check meadowblog.net for last-minute updates and weather advisories.
